Description du poste

As a Field Clinical Specialist (Field Clinical Liaison) you will be the first point of contact for dentists and orthodontists in your region and be responsible for clinical education, communication, and support of both external and internal customers. Your mission is to provide customers the best clinical education and help them to become expert on Invisalign technique, increasing their clinical confidence. You will be travelling around the designated area to visit doctors in their clinical practices to improve their knowledge about the Invisalign technique.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ide clinical support and education to orthodontists and general dentists, assisting with case assessments, treatment evaluations, ClinCheck support, and troubleshooting.
  • Address customer inquiries, complaints, and adverse events related to clinical issues, ensuring all relevant details are documented in the CRM system.
  • Build and maintain peer-to-peer relationships with healthcare professionals, guiding them through treatment planning and the adoption of new digital workflows.
  • Deliver coaching to healthcare professionals, helping them become educators and share their knowledge with peers.
  • Plan and execute educational roundtable discussions and other interactive events to foster case discussions and peer-to-peer learning.
  • Work closely with Marketing, Customer Support, and Sales teams to deliver Align’s educational programs, contributing to the achievement of business goals.
  • Independently contribute to key projects, as well as work collaboratively with others to provide input and support on larger initiatives.
  • Plan and organize visits and group sessions independently, ensuring timely coordination with the sales team to achieve business objectives.
  • Seek and recommend new approaches to improve healthcare professionals' learning experiences and enhance digital workflow adoption.
  • Regularly travel to conduct structured certification and education programs for customers and visit their practices for deeper educational engagement.
  • Manage relationships with speakers and Key Opinion Leaders (KOLs) to support educational initiatives.

Skills, Knowledge & Expertise

  • Master’s degree from a four-year college or university preferred (dentistry).
  • Typically has 3-5 years of directly related experience.
  • Possess proficient negotiation, challenger approach as well as didactical / presentation and facilitator skills.
  • Has the ability to train medical staff in using the product effectively
  • Ability to travel in the assigned geography 70% of the time.
  • Fluent in French, proficiency in English
  • Based in Bordeaux
